Walking a Dog Keeps You Fit

You may be aware that government guidelines for keeping healthy are for you to get 150 minutes of moderate exercise every week. One way to do that and do even more is to get a dog.

A study involving hundreds of British households found that dog owners are four times more likely than other people to meet this standard. They also found that most dog owners will far exceed this standard by the walking close to 300 minutes a week with their dogs.

When the researchers compared the dog walkers with non-dog walkers, the dog walkers had 200 more minutes a week that they were doing.
